Position: Academic Coach Type: Public Location: Rural Job ID: 121426 County: Apache Posted: March 04, 2024 Contact Information: Chinle Unified School District PO Box 587 Chinle, ARIZONA 86503 District Website Contact: Colleen Yazzie Phone: Fax: District Email Job Description: General Description: Work collaboratively with the school principal, District Master Teacher and the school leadership team to analyze student data and create and implement an academic achievement plan for the school. Academic Coaches lead cluster groups and provide demonstration lessons, coaching, model teaching and team teaching to career teachers. They also spend time working directly with students and teachers on strategies to improve student achievement and instructional effectiveness. Academic Coaches conduct follow up support activities with career teachers to support implementation of new instructional strategies and conduct teacher evaluations. Qualifications: 1. Bachelor's degree from an accredited institution, Master's preferred. 2. Valid Arizona teaching certificate. 3. Strong organizational, communication (written and oral), and interpersonal skills. 4. Extensive knowledge of curriculum and instruction appropriate for grade level campus assignment and core subject area. 5. Ability to provide high quality instruction to students and communicate with peers and supervisors in a collegial coaching atmosphere. 6. Extensive knowledge of instructional technology integration with core curriculum. 7. Ability to interpret data especially for the purposes of instructional decision-making. 8. Effective presentation skills such as classroom demonstrations, team teaching, model teaching 9. Student data that illustrates the teachers's ability to increase student achievement through utilizing specific instructional strategies and interventions. 10. Experience providing professional development to adult learners preferred. Duties and Responsibilities: 1. Participate in the leadership team with responsibilities to include but not limited to: o analyzing student data to identify student learning goals; o developing a school academic achievement plan; o coordinating a cluster assessment plan with the school assessment plan; o monitoring goal-setting and activities; o classroom follow up and goal attainment for cluster groups and Individual Growth Plans (IGPs); o assess teacher evaluation results and o support inter-rater reliability.
